Okay, so it's a well known problem, I think, that many users don't really read the stickies. I have a solution. I think that, just like Scratch tracks which topics you've read, that Scratch should also track whether you've recently (or at all) read the stickies. If you haven't, I think that when the new topic button is pressed, that this image (or something similar) should come up.
